JM Bullion, Bold Precious Metals, BGASC, Hero Bullion, SilverGoldBull, Monument Metals, APMEX, BullionExchanges, Ayden Coins, Monarch Precious Metals are all good places from where I have made purchases. You can also see if you have a local coin shop. Whatever you do, shop around, as the prices can vary alot. Avoid ebay, instagram, Facebook purchases for now, until you get more experience. Avoid deals that look too good to be true.
